In the third of our series of papers on financial-market regulation, the Global Markets Institute explores specific proposals that could help restore transparency to financial markets. We outline principles that could reduce opportunities for financial holding companies to arbitrage regulatory and accounting standards, asset pricing and risk controls. We illustrate our ideas with simplified case studies of some key arbitrage problems.
